Muna Otaru inMoviesSort Popularity Votes Average Original Title Release Date Lions for Lambs 6 average rating ★★★★★ Rendition 6.436 average rating ★★★★★ The Keeping Room 5.756 average rating ★★★★★ Surge 5.5 average rating ★★★★★ Damilola, Our Loved Boy 6 average rating ★★★★★ Little River Run 0 average rating ★★★★★